Space Program Materials Engineer
-Materials and Processes selection, testing, and validation for custom hardware and COTS items flown for IVA and EVA environments on the International Space Station and commercial crew vehicles (Orion, Crew Dragon, CST-100)-Proposal writing for prospective contracts: wrote technical approach for Leidos' winning proposal to build navigation targets for the Gateway Power and Propulsion Element-market surveys for new technology: helium removal from habitable spacecraft, high accuracy flow meters in micro gravity-Failure analysis (metallic, polymeric, and composite materials systems)
Graduate Researcher
Current research focuses on investigating the effects of process parameters on the chemistry, band alignment, and transport properties at the interface formed between a variety of contact material–transition metal dichalcogenide (TMD) pairs. X-ray and Ultraviolet Photoelectron Spectroscopy, Atomic Force Microscopy, and Scanning Tunneling Microscopy/Spectroscopy are employed both in-situ and ex-situ to investigate the evolution of chemical states and band alignment prior to and following metallization and post metallization treatments as well as the topography and local density of states, respectively. This work highlights the contact–TMD interface is not pristine or abrupt in many cases as many in the community have assumed and the interface chemistry contributes substantially to the resulting contact performance in these systems. In addition, variable temperature (I–V–T) and frequency (C–V–T) measurements have been employed to investigate the dominant carrier transport mechanism(s) and correlate interface and contact chemistry with electrical behavior. The ultimate goal of this research is to connect processing conditions with contact performance through detailed characterization. This work helps optimize TMD–based devices, pushing the technology towards commercial viability.
